Purchasing and Material Management
Essay by mrmac0251 • September 5, 2018 • Term Paper • 1,752 Words (8 Pages) • 935 Views
Time management is an important factor in project planning and execution, and project plan is an integral part of any modern business. Today there are various types of task scheduling instrumental, but Gantt chart is still one of the most popular among them. Gantt chart was developed by Henry Gantt as a method of project’s schedule visualization. Since 1910, these chart has become an integral component of planning; it allows to visualize the beginning the end of the project along with each element or task that needs to be done. Since many tasks are dependent on previous charts, it’s possible to see these dependencies and consider them why creating a long-term plan.
The project we are about to manage is a software-development process, which is coordinated by Agile principles. Agile is a flexible development methodology, where after each iteration the customer can observe the result and understand whether it satisfies it or not. Due to the lack of specific formulations of results, it is difficult to assess the labor costs and costs required for development in the beginning of the process. The project’s team consists of 11 people, who work on the same task division, consisting of Product manager, Product Marketing Manager, Project manager, two Android and iOS developers and QA-engineers.
All tasks of the team begin with project’s preparatory phase. The purpose of the phase is to create a certain concept of the future system on the basis of the customer's proposals and, based on this concept, to assess the relevance and feasibility of the project. If the decision to attract an executor is taken by the customer on a competitive basis, then the preliminary stage is, in fact, the stage of preparation of the potential executor for the competition, including the formation of the necessary documentation. The project, the concept of which appears to be acceptable for implementation, goes to the stage of development of requirements. At this stage, the performer must form a list of all the explicit and hidden needs of the customer. It often turns out that the customer either does not determine his needs, or his needs conflict with each other, with the capabilities of the customer or with the capabilities of the performer. The objectives of the phase are to identify all hidden needs, resolve conflicts of requirements, formulate a holistic technical solution and analyze the feasibility of a prepared solution. Gantt charts provide the ability to effectively organize the working process. In order to create a task plan according to Gantt, firstly, it’s necessary to identify a complete list of all project tasks and the time required to perform each of them. Because of the relative complexity of this method, some managers are questioning its benefits for small businesses. One of the reasons for this is there is a need to focus on the most important tasks and then break them into groups and subtasks before execution in order to accurately evaluate your efficiency and set precise deadlines. This time of managing helps to establish a timeline and facilitate project planning.
Sometimes clarification of requirements leads to a revision of the concept of the project. If, after clarifying all the requirements, it is not possible to find an acceptable technical solution, the project has to be curtailed or delayed for a while in anticipation of more acceptable circumstances. Due to the fact that many processes often depend on each other, it is difficult to calculate how much time it takes for the task to be completed. The columns in the Gantt chart are used as an indicator of the time that must be devoted to the task, and thus it gets a more extensive and detailed picture of the project and its time frames. It’s important to consider holidays, days off and settle a few emergency days for each process, as the next division of subtasks could miss the deadlines if the previous parts would miss deadlines. However, both of the points and series represent the hierarchical collection that allows, for example, to submit a project as a set of related, hierarchical tasks. Many task divisions allow to display various data, such as holiday, business trip and sick leave on the same chart. There is a possibility of setting the links between different intervals of the charts, thus the end of one interval may be associated with the beginning of the following interval chart.
After completing the design of the architecture, it is necessary to revisit the main parameters of the project again and decide whether the executor is able to complete the project. It is useful at the stage of developing the architecture to refuse excessive and too cumbersome functions. Optimizing an architectural solution often helps to fit into acceptable project parameters; in other cases, a more radical reduction of the functionality of the system under development is required (White, 2015) . However, even stopping the project at this stage, if it occurs for good reasons, should be perceived as a victory: the continuation of works in this case can only lead to even greater losses. For this stage of project’s development, the Gantt chart provides an ability to support of the special software for project planning to facilitate complex calculations and dependencies, and run the what-if analysis. Moreover, in one table every team is able to see the whole project, broken into separate tasks. In addition, by means of a Gantt chart to allocate resources to tasks and calculate a budget; it also allows to simulate different situations. Scheduling projects using Gantt charts, it’s easy to create groups of project participants at the same chart and set tasks for different groups, controlling all at once (Siciliano, 2009) . The manager of the process can quickly update the information so that each participant is aware of the changes.
Gantt chart is visually optimized; it provides the excellent opportunity to monitor all parts of the project linearly, which allows the user to clearly determine what should be done next. The chart has highly customizable appearance. With various fonts, colors, display time intervals for each value displayed in the chart, it’s easy to specify an explanatory inscription.This planning method also allows to determine the milestones of the project stage and to identify the key tasks if you plan long-term projects, which improves clarification of requirements for the team. The diagram provides a flexible and interactive software adjust the zoom of the view (Kumar, 2005) . Regardless of the current size of the chart to display the set time interval (which can automatically be determined depending on the current data), there is a possibility to display a visible area of any given interval.
Despite the fact that
...
...